Home

Communication Horizons
established 1986

Home
Contact

 

Knowledgebase Index
About Us
Contact
Legacy Products


Communication Horizons
65 High Ridge Rd. #428
Stamford CT 06905

info@netlib.com

800-480-1604
203-321-1278
fax  286-1056

       

Knowledgebase


>>ITEM: R00045

>>DATE: April 5, 1996

>>TYPE: Information

>>TITLE: Btrieve error 5 - duplicate key value

>>PRODUCT(S): RaSQL/B RDD 6.1x for Clipper

>>PLATFORM(S):
Clipper 5.0, 5.2, 5.3. Btrieve (all versions)

>>SUMMARY:
RaSQL/B generates Btrieve error 5 - duplicate key value - after APPEND BLANK.

>>MORE INFORMATION:
Btrieve returns this error when an index has been flagged as unique, and you attempt to add a new record with a non-unique key value. In the case of APPEND BLANK, it means that a blank record already exists in the file.

>>RESOLUTION/FIX:
First, if using RaSQL/B 6.0, you must upgrade to 6.1. Next, specify N_XHARDWRITE(.F.) immediately after N_XLOGIN.

>>EXAMPLE(S):

>>COPYRIGHT 1997 Communication Horizons
All rights reserved worldwide. No distribution without specific consent of publisher.


Knowledgebase Top Home

 

© Copyright 2001 Communication Horizons LLC.
“NetLib” and “Encryptionizer” are Registered Trademarks of Communication Horizons.
US and international patents pending.
Updated 29 Dec 2001